80 abducted Islammiyya school girls rescued in Katsina State

A joint security operation by the police, military, and vigilante groups have about 80 girls in Mahuta village in Dandume local government area of Katsina State.

This is coming less than 48 hours after 344 abducted school boys of Government Science Secondary School, GSSS Kankara regained freedom.

Spokesman of the Katsina State Police command, SP Gambo Isah, who confirmed the incident to ait.live debunked claims that, the girls were all abducted.

According to him, on December 19 at about 6pm, some pupils of Hizburrahim Islamiyya in Mahuta village numbering about 80, while on their way home from a Maulud occassion celebrated at Unguwan Alkasim village in Dandume were accosted by bandits.

He said the girls on the procession met the bandits who had already kidnapped four persons and rustled 12 cows from Danbaure village of Funtua local government area trying to escape into the forest.

Isah added that as a result of the incident, the District Police Officer of Dandume after receiving a distress call immediately mobilised joint team of Operation Puff Adder, Operation Saharan Daji and some members of the vigilante group to the scene where they engaged the bandits in a gun duel.

He said, the teams succeeded in dislodging the bandits and rescued all the kidnapped victims and recovered all the 12 rustled cows.

The police image maker further added that, search parties are still combing the area with a view to arresting the injured bandits and to recover their dead bodies while all the girls who earlier scampered for safety have been found from neighbouring villages.

He therefore debunked claims that 80 girls have been kidnapped while adding that, investigation is still on going.
